1. Proveedores de software comercial:
* Naturaleza: Estas empresas desarrollan y venden productos de software para obtener ganancias. A menudo proporcionan una amplia gama de soluciones de software adaptadas a industrias o necesidades específicas.
* Ejemplos: Microsoft (Windows, Office), Adobe (Photoshop, Acrobat), Salesforce (software CRM), SAP (planificación de recursos empresariales), Oracle (software de base de datos).
* pros: Generalmente bien probado, confiable y apoyado. A menudo ofrece integración con otros productos y servicios.
* contras: Puede ser costoso, puede requerir tarifas de licencia, opciones de personalización limitadas y no siempre satisfacer todas las necesidades específicas.
2. Comunidades de código abierto:
* Naturaleza: Este es un modelo de desarrollo de software colaborativo donde el código fuente está disponible gratuitamente para que cualquiera lo use, modifique y distribuya. Los proyectos a menudo son impulsados por contribuciones voluntarias.
* Ejemplos: Sistema operativo de Linux, servidor web Apache, base de datos MySQL, sistema de administración de contenido de WordPress, sistema operativo móvil Android.
* pros: Free de uso, personalizable, a menudo muy robusto debido a las contribuciones de una gran comunidad, fomenta la innovación.
* contras: Puede requerir experiencia técnica para implementar, el apoyo puede variar según la comunidad, pueden estar presentes las preocupaciones de seguridad.
3. Proveedores de software como servicio (SaaS):
* Naturaleza: Las empresas SaaS entregan aplicaciones de software a través de Internet, a los que se accede a través de navegadores web o aplicaciones móviles. Los usuarios se suscriben al servicio, pagando una tarifa recurrente.
* Ejemplos: Google Workspace (Gmail, Docs, Sheets), Dropbox (almacenamiento en la nube), Zoom (videoconferencia), Slack (Plataforma de comunicación), Spotify (transmisión de música).
* pros: Accesible desde cualquier lugar, sin necesidad de instalación o mantenimiento local, actualizaciones regulares, a menudo escalables, modelos de precios de pago por uso.
* contras: La dependencia de la conectividad a Internet, las posibles preocupaciones de seguridad de datos, la personalización limitada, no siempre se pueden integrar bien con los sistemas existentes.